In the maker’s words, at launch

ChatGPT Code Interpreter is a game changer for data cleaning, analysis, and plotting, but as early users my friend @amauboussin and I were frustrated that there is no easy way to work on top of its results. You can’t edit code, install packages, work on large datasets, collaborate with teammates, or use it for privacy-sensitive workloads. So we built Juno to bring the power of Code Interpreter to your local Jupyter notebook. It understands your data, generates code directly in your notebook, and can fix its own errors. We’ve found ourselves using it for tons of analysis tasks at our startups, so we decided to release it to everyone!
